Yes, shiny pokemon can be breed. However, breeding shiny pokemon does not increase the chances of having shiny offspring, except for in Generation II games.

It is a 1 in every 8 734 Pokemon that is shiny. you can tell because it sparkles and glitters. Eg: A normal Gyarados is blue, but if it is red, and glitters, then it is shiny. When it is in your party, a red star is beside the Pokemon.
